Miriam Ruiz wrote:
> I think that the reasons mentioned against the usage of patches inside a svn
> repository make a lot of sense, I'd like to know how many people in the group
> prefer which option.
Just to clarify since "patches" applies to several suggestions made on
this list... I would recommend people just store their debian/ directory
(using whatever method to store patches therein) in svn and the
upstream tarball. Importing and maintaining the entire upstream source
tree + diff.gz can get fairly messy.
